Comprehending Car Ignition Systems

The ignition system of an automobile is a crucial element responsible for beginning the engine. It creates the stimulate needed for combustion in the engine cylinders. The main elements of an ignition system typically consist of:

  • Ignition Coil: Converts the battery's voltage into a higher voltage required to produce a trigger.
  • Spark Plugs: Deliver the electrical trigger to the engine cylinders.
  • Ignition Switch: Activates the ignition system when the key is turned.
  • Circuitry: Connects all components of the ignition system.

Understanding how these parts work in unison can help car owners detect problems and determine when expert assistance is required.

Signs Your Ignition System Needs Repair

Numerous symptoms may indicate that your ignition system is failing. Recognizing these signs early can save you time and cash. Here are some common indications that you might need ignition repair:

  1. Engine Won't Start: The most obvious indication; if turning the key produces no sound or the engine cranks without starting, there may be an ignition issue.
  2. Intermittent Starting Problems: If the engine starts great sometimes however not others, there might be a fault in the ignition system.
  3. Control Panel Warning Lights: A lit check engine light or specific Ignition Cylinder Lock Repair system caution can suggest a malfunction.
  4. Engine Misfiring: When the stimulate plugs do not fire properly, you might discover rough idling, sputtering, or loss of power.
  5. No Accessories or Power: If turning the key does not result in dashboard lights beginning or other accessory function, the ignition switch may be the perpetrator.
  6. Uncommon Noises: A clicking noise when you turn the key can suggest battery concerns or a failing starter, which may also include the ignition system.

Steps to Take If You Experience Ignition Issues

If you notice any of the signs above, follow these actions.

  1. Inspect the Battery: Ensure the battery is charged and the terminals are tidy.
  2. Inspect Fuses and Relays: A blown fuse or a defective relay can trigger ignition problems.
  3. Examine the Key: Sometimes, a worn-out key can avoid the ignition switch from engaging.
  4. Examine the Wiring: Inspect the visible wiring for wear or rust.
  5. Seek Professional Help: If the problem persists, it's time to contact an expert mechanic.

FAQs About Car Ignition Repair

What is the typical cost of ignition repair?

The cost of ignition repair can differ commonly depending on the intricacy of the problem and your vehicle's make and design. Usually, you may anticipate to pay in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 400 for basic repairs. Nevertheless, more extensive issues can reach upwards of ₤ 1,000.

The length of time does ignition repair take?

The period for ignition repairs differs depending upon the specific issue. Easy fixes can be completed in an hour, while more intricate repairs may take numerous hours or even a full day.

Can I fix my car's ignition myself?

Some small ignition problems can be handled by DIY lovers, such as changing trigger plugs or inspecting the battery. Nevertheless, more complicated issues, particularly those including electronic devices, must preferably be delegated specialists.
